The New Year started off strong with a home win predicated on defense for the Phoenix Suns (12-21) at home against a team coming in on a back-to-back. It appears the New Year is full of gifts for the team as the Utah Jazz come in off of a back-to-back as well with the Suns well rested.
This is the perfect game for the Suns to get their season on track and an equally dreadful position to lay an egg against a winnable opponent.
Overall the Jazz have been a formidable opponent despite the Suns taking charge as of late winning 8/10 in the series. Each team has drawn blood at home this season with this being a "rubber match" of sorts for the season. This game is going to come down to defense as the Suns give up only 95.82 points per game at home and the Jazz are giving up 99.2 points overall.
Whoever can play the best grind it out type game will come out victorious.

Interesting Stat: 1,999
The Suns can win their 2,000 game tonight becoming the fourth fastest team in the history of the league to get there behind only the Philadelphia 76ers (3,125), Los Angeles Lakers (3,262), and the Boston Celtics (3,564). All have championships and over a decade on the Suns in the NBA Overall. Impressive consistency.
